A few days in the area  Sucess!

After a night at Alltbeithe I traversed the unpronounceable Sgurr nan Ceathreamhnan. I hiked out to the west coast via Gleann Choinneachain, camping somewhere along the way.

Four visits in 2017   Sucess!

With no trips abroad planned for 2017 I did something I have been meaning to do for around 30 years and visited Glen Affric to do some winter mountaineering in February. We climbed Sgurr nan Ceathreamhnan west top, Mam Sodhail 2nd highest in range at 1181m and about 3 tops. I returned on my own in June and having climbed Mam Sodhail again, this time reached top of highest in the range Carn Eighe 1183m and continued on down the range over 4 'tops' as far as Tom a’Choinich 1112m in one 12 hour day covering about 17 miles and climbing around 1600m in the process. By this time I had fallen in love with the area and had already decided I wanted to visit in the two remaining seasons of high summer and autumn. I had in mind writing this page at the end of it all.
